What does Tavon mean?

Tavon is a boy name of Modern origin meaning “invented name”. A modern American coinage, possibly blending Ta- with Von.

How popular is Tavon?

Tavon is an uncommon baby name in the United States. It was most common in 1996, when it ranked #1,760 nationally (given to 192 babies that year).
